L A s virtual congress offers participants hope, vision for the future

Archbishop José H. Gomez of Los Angeles, president of the U.S. Conference of Catholic Bishops, delivers his closing homily Feb. 21, 2021, for the annual Los Angeles archdiocesan Religious Education Congress, which was held virtually because of the pandemic. (CNS screen grab/Religious Education Congress via YouTube) Los Angeles For Jesus parents, answering God s call meant their whole lives were turned upside down, not unlike the events of the past year, Los Angeles Archbishop José H. Gomez said Feb. 21 at the close of the all-virtual 2021 Religious Education Congress. Reminding participants of the Year of St. Joseph recently declared by Pope Francis, he made the case that Mary and Joseph give us a beautiful example for our ministries in this moment.
